New Delhi, Apr 19 (UNI) Chief Secretaries of States will come together here tomorrow to discuss measures to streamline overall governance and work out a strategy to improve the internal security situation.

A day-long meeting, being organised by the Department of Administrative Reforms and Public Grievances, would also discuss issues pertaining to food security, Sarva Shiksha Abhiyan and National Rural Health Mission.

A special focus would be laid on measures to be taken to improve the overall business climate in the country, official sources said here today.

Cabinet Secretary B K Chaturvedi would inaugurate the Conference.

The conference serves the twin purposes of assessing the performance of different states over a period of time, as also, appraisal of the progress made in respect of various flagship programmes of different nodal Ministries of the Union Government.

Over a period of time, this has proved to be a useful platform to deliberate upon critical issues like law and order, education, health, employment and rural development.

"Not only this, such a conference proves useful in sorting out issues constraining speedy implementation of centrally sponsored and central sector schemes," sources said.
